
Installation view, The Lucky Hand
Greene Naftali, New York, 2011

Christmas Eve, 2010
Acrylic on canvas
90 1/2 x 70 7/8 inches (230 x 180 cm)

Soul Digested, 2010
Acrylic on canvas
70 3/4 x 90 1/2 inches (180 x 230 cm)

The Explosion, 2010
Acrylic on canvas
90 1/2 x 126 inches
230 x 320 cm

The Dancing Devil, 2010
Acrylic on canvas
90 1/2 x 70 3/4 inches (230 x 180 cm)

The Shooting of a Violinist, 2010
Acrylic on canvas
63 x 47 1/4 inches (160 x 120 cm)

Structural Harmony, 2010
Acrylic on canvas
47 1/4x 63 inches (120 x 160 cm)

Installation view, The Lucky Hand
Greene Naftali, New York, 2011